In the fast-paced world of Bollywood, where rumors spread like wildfire, choreographer Vijay Ganguly recently took to Instagram to address a swirling controversy surrounding actress Tamannaah Bhatia and the much-talked-about song "Shararat" from the upcoming film Dhurandhar. Directed by Aditya Dhar, the movie has already generated buzz for its intense narrative, and Ganguly's clarification sheds light on the behind-the-scenes decisions that prioritize storytelling over celebrity glamour. Let's dive into the details of his statement, exploring the creative vision, the chosen performers, and his pointed critique of media hype.

The Spark of the Controversy

It all started with an interview Ganguly gave to a popular entertainment portal, where he casually mentioned envisioning Tamannaah Bhatia for the "Shararat" sequence. Before long, headlines exploded across social media and news outlets, framing the story as a "rejection" by the director. Fans and critics alike speculated wildly, turning what was meant to be a light-hearted chat into a sensational drama. Ganguly, known for his work on hit tracks in films like Stree and Bhool Bhulaiyaa 2, felt compelled to set the record straight. In his Instagram post, he emphasized that the word "rejection" was never part of his vocabulary in this context, calling out how quickly narratives can spiral out of control.


Prioritizing Story Over Stardom

At the heart of Ganguly's explanation is a commitment to the film's artistic integrity. Dhurandhar isn't your typical Bollywood flick with flashy item numbers; instead, "Shararat" is woven into a high-tension scene where the music serves the plot rather than stealing the spotlight. Ganguly explained that Tamannaah's immense popularity and star aura—undeniably one of the biggest draws in Indian cinema today—could have overshadowed the sequence's subtle dynamics. "Her presence is so commanding that it might shift the focus away from the story's core," he noted in his clarification. This decision reflects a broader trend in modern filmmaking, where directors like Aditya Dhar opt for elements that enhance the narrative flow rather than relying on big names to pull crowds. It's a refreshing reminder that sometimes, less star power allows the plot to shine brighter, creating a more immersive experience for audiences.


The Perfect Fit: Ayesha Khan and Krystle D'Souza

Instead of going with a solo star, the team behind Dhurandhar chose to feature two talented performers who could blend seamlessly into the scene's requirements. Ayesha Khan, known for her vibrant energy from reality shows and web series, and Krystle D'Souza, a television favorite with a knack for emotive roles, were handpicked for their ability to support the storyline without dominating it. Ganguly praised their selection, highlighting how their fresh chemistry adds layers to the tension-filled moment. This duo approach ensures the song feels organic to the film's high-stakes atmosphere, proving that casting is about synergy, not just individual fame. Fans are already excited to see how these actresses bring "Shararat" to life, potentially marking a breakout moment for both in the big-screen arena.

Calling Out Media Sensationalism

What truly irked Ganguly was the media's tendency to twist words for clicks. He expressed deep frustration over how his innocent mention was blown up into tales of rejection and rivalry. "Cinema is a collaborative art form built on respect and nuance," he wrote, urging outlets to focus on the creative process instead of pitting artists against each other. This isn't the first time Bollywood has seen such distortions—sensational headlines often prioritize drama over facts, eroding the industry's collaborative spirit. Ganguly's post serves as a call to action for more responsible reporting, hoping to redirect attention to the hard work and innovation that go into making films like Dhurandhar.
